French Dip Sandwich

French Dip Sandwich

Flavors Used:

If there’s one thing I love, it’s taking flavors from all over and marrying them into one Dantastic, over-the-top, Dan-o-myte bite. This French Dip sandwich brings pot-roast tenderness together with Italian-beef attitude, finished with that bold Blackened Bloody Mary kick that pulls it all together.

Ingredients

For the Beef

  • 3 tbsp Dan-O’s Outlaw Blackened Bloody Mary Seasoning
  • 3 lb chuck roast
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 4 celery stalks, cut into large chunks
  • 1 large onion, quartered
  • 4 carrots, cut into large chunks
  • 1 packet au jus mix
  • 2 cups beef broth (after deglazing)
  • 1 (16 oz) jar pepperoncini peppers with the juice

For the Sandwich

  • 1 tbsp Dan-O’s Outlaw Blackened Bloody Mary Seasoning
  • 1 large Chicago-style Italian loaf (or large French loaf)
  • 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1–1.5 cups giardiniera (mild or hot)

Preparation Instructions

  1. Season & Sear the Roast: Coat the chuck roast with oil. Season generously with Blackened Bloody Mary.
  2. Heat a skillet with a little oil until very hot. Sear the roast 1–2 minutes per side until deeply browned. Transfer the roast to your Instant Pot.
  3. Build Your Flavor Base: Deglaze the hot pan with a splash of beef broth, scraping all browned bits. Add celery, carrots, and onions. Add Dan-O’s Outlaw Blackened Bloody Mary, Au jus packet, deglazed beef broth, and the jar of pepperoncini peppers with the juice
  4. Pressure Cook: Seal the Instant Pot. Cook on High Pressure for 2.5 hours. Let it naturally release. Ideally 45–60 minutes.
  5. Strain & Prepare the Meat: Remove the roast and place on a cutting board. Strain the cooking liquid and save the juice for dipping. Discard vegetables. Chop or shred the beef into tender chunks.
  6. Toast the Bread: Slice your Italian loaf lengthwise. Place in a 400°F oven for about 5 minutes until lightly crusted.
  7. Build the Sandwich: Bottom half: pile on all the chopped roast beef. Top half: spread giardiniera evenly from end to end. Add shredded mozzarella to both sides (heavy is the way). Sprinkle generously with Dan-O’s Outlaw Blackened Bloody Mary.
  8. Return the whole assembled loaf to the 400°F oven. Bake for 8–10 minutes until the cheese is melted and bubbling.
  9. Slice into hearty pieces and serve with a cup of that reserved au jus for dipping. Yum yum get ya sum!
